How long does it take to play a full game of Monopoly?

It takes between 20 minutes and three or more hours to play, depending on the number of players and what you roll. In Monopoly, players are competing to bankrupt their opponents by purchasing property and building houses and hotels to charge the most rent when their rivals land on the spaces.

What is speed Monopoly?

Monopoly: Speed is played through a series of four timed rounds wherein players move and buy their properties all at once instead of taking turns. Everyone gets their own unique token and dice to roll, which they're free to use as much as they can before the timer sounds.

Is there a 1000 in Monopoly?

The modern Monopoly game has its Monopoly money denominated in $1, $5, $10, $20, $50, $100, $500, and (in some editions) $1,000, with all but the last two paralleling the denominations in circulation in the United States.

How many $1 is in Monopoly?

Monopoly money consists of 20 orange $500 bills, 20 beige $100 bills, 30 blue $50 bills, 50 green $20 bills, 40 yellow $10 bills, 40 pink $5 bills, and 40 white $1 bills.

What is $200 in Monopoly money?

Monopoly rules, explained

Each time a player makes their way around the board and lands on or passes GO, the banker pays them $200. The $200 is paid for every complete pass of the board, meaning if a player passes GO twice in a game, they collect $200 twice, $400 in total.

Is Monopoly slow?

An average game of Monopoly should last for around 45 minutes. With only two players, the game will often (but not always) be quicker, but with more than four players it can take 90 minutes, or sometimes longer.

Why is it called Monopoly?

The game is named after the economic concept of a monopoly—the domination of a market by a single entity.

Do you use 2 dice in Monopoly?

In the game of Monopoly, a pair of dice are rolled to move a player's piece around the board. If a double is rolled (the dice show the same number), the player receives another roll of the dice.
